I actually feel like it is ideal. You don't want outside input affecting the processing and decision making of the vehicle. This would leave them vulnerable to attacks.
Also it then requires a whole nother dimension in programming and understanding that the car needs.
It's actually problematic when human drivers try to do "kind" things and give each other the go-ahead in spite of the actual right of way, and things would be safer if everyone actually performed exactly as the rules dictated.
Adding that to automated systems which already have the ability to follow the road rules more or less exactly (assuming accurate input data) just introduces vulnerability for exploitation to solve the wrong problem (inadequate input/visibility/context). Robot drivers should ignore "actually, you go first" for all of the same reasons humans should and the OP is actually a good demonstration of exactly why that's the case.

One of the best pieces of advice I received while learning to drive was "Don't be polite, be predictable". And the best way to be predictable is to follow the rules.
